News – DAKAR, Senegal (AP) -- Africa's nearly two dozen wars in recent decades have robbed the continent of about $18 billion a year that could have gone to helping one of the world's poorest regions build stronger economies, according to a report being released Thursday.

Food – "McDonald's Corp., which sold its first hamburger 52 years ago, says it now sells more chicken than Kentucky Fried Chicken. ... The company had chicken sales of $5.2 billion in the 12 months through March, pushing it past Yum! Brands Inc.'s KFC chain, McDonald's spokeswoman Heidi Barker said."
